At track practice,Sheila worked on the long jump. Her first jump measured 3 yards, 2 feet, 8 inches. Her second jump measured 2

yards,1 foot, 10 inches. What was the total lenght of shielas two jumps? Express your answer in feet
Mathematics
1 answer:
jolli1 [7]3 years ago
7 0
The length is 19.5 feet. this is because when you add the yards, it equals 15 feet. Next, add 1 + 2 feet from the first and second jump. 10+8 inches equal 1.5 feet. Next, add 15 feet+3 feet+1.5 feet to get 19.5 feet.

Evaluate the expression for b = 7<br> 6b + 8 – 5b
bearhunter [10]

Answer:

For b = 7, the expression equals 15.

Step-by-step explanation:

6b + 8 - 5b

Substitute the variable b = 7.

6(7) + 8 - 5(7)

Multiply.

42 + 8 - 35

Add.

50 - 35

Subtract.

15.
